
你这段代码前面是在ASP里复制过来的吧?asp与VB是不同的。正确的写法应该是这样:
Dim Coon as New ADODBConnection '连接数据库
Connstr = "Provider=MicrosoftJetOLEDB40;Data Source=" & accpath & ";" '连接数据库的地址,调用 accpath
CoonOpen Connstr
Dim rs As New ADODBRecordset
''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''
Sql = "SELECT sclass FROM SClass where sclass = '" & fenlei & "'"
rsOpen Sql, Coon, adOpenStatic, adLockReadOnly
If Not rsEOF Then
MsgBox "它说有数据"
MsgBox sclassid
Else
rsaddnew '添加新记录
rs!sclass=fenlei
rsUpdate '保存
MsgBox "它说没有,但是我写入了"
Msgbox sclassid
End If
关于SELECT的无限联动菜单
indexasp
程序代码:
<html>
<head>
<title></title>
<meta content="text/html; charset=gb2312" >
无限关系在数据库系统中是有意义的(错误)
关系作为关系数据模型的数据结构时,需给予以下限定和扩充
1、无限关系在数据库系统中无意义
元组个数是无限的
限定关系数据模型中的关系必须是有限集合。
2、为关系的每个列附加一个属性名来取消元组的有序性
即(d1,d2,…,di,dj,…,dn)=(d1,d2,…, dj, di,…, dn) (i,j=1,2 ,…, n )
关系的基本性质
1 列是同质的,每一列的分量是同一类型的数据,来自同一域。
2 不同的列可出自同一域(即笛卡尔积定义中Di可以相同)
3 列的顺序可以任意交换。
4 任意两个元组的候选码不能完全相同。
5 行的次序可以任意交换。
6 分量必须取原子值。
数据记录数,因为,并发指在前段的是>
楼主,你要求写出代码这个就不是三言两语搞得定了。。。
详细请看我最近开发的:>
分太少了
实现无限分类,一个表搞定 表type
ID(主键) parentID(父级id) typeName(分类名) treeStr(树型字符串)
1 0 食品
2 1 肉类 1
3 2 猪肉 1,2
查询父级ID=1的全部子类SQL
SELECT bID FROM `type` as a, `type` as b where aparentID=1 and(bparentID=aID or bID=aID)
我觉得你的数据库可以设计成这样
id(编号) name(分类名称)superiorsid(父级分类id)
无论你插入哪行数据只要 写入对应的父级分类ID就行了
比如说你插入水果分类
1 水果
那要是苹果的话就可以是
2 苹果 1
(其中的1 指的就是水果)
要是桔子的话就可以是
3 桔子 1
如果是苹果中的红富士那插入的就是
4 红富士 2
大致这样就能实现你的无限级分类了
如果用jsp实现级联菜单的话 最好用AJAX技术
以上就是关于数据库难题全部的内容,包括:数据库难题、求asp无限级树型菜单源代码,最好是带数据库的!、无限关系在数据库系统中是有意义的等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)